| ~Maya~ |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
| Maya came to me at 5 1/2 years of age. She is not a typical Aussie because of her beautiful tail, perk ears, and white face. She is my example to people of a dog that was loved to much. She is extremely dominant aggressive and will bite to get her own way. When I took Maya in she was extremely food, resource, touch aggressive, and was plainly out of control. We've battled through a lot of her problems with tears and blood shed. Underneath it all she can be a wonderful dog. She is my 'take-down' dog, my partner in working other aggressive dogs, and my noisy distraction dog. She has been the hardest dog that I have ever had to work with and as a result I have learned many different styles & methods of training because of her. Although I have to manage her aggression on a daily basis she is dear to my heart knowing how drastically she has changed from the first day I brought her home. Maya will be 8 yrs this spring.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

| ~Finn~ |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
| Finn is my hope for a show-stopper. By 10 weeks of age he already knew all his basic commands and a few tricks. He is showing a lot of herding instinct at 5 months, and is a real deal border collie! I have high hopes for him as a partner in obedience and trick and frisbee work. In March, Finn & I joined Redline Dogsports Flyball Team. In three weeks he has mastered running the hurdles, and is developing a nice swimmer's turn off the box. He is very calm at practice - quietly watching the older dogs run the relay - but he drives hard when his turn comes around. Obedience, frisbee, flyball...his next challenges will be agility & herding! I don't think there will be anything he can't do! |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

| Blazingstar Brown Ruff WC CD ~ INDY |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
| Indy is an amazing dog to work with as he strives to please his handler in any way he can. He has exibited his working ability in field trails and most recently in the Alberta Kennel Club obedience ring (Feb.'07). To the delight of myself, and his owners, Indy received his CD title in his first try and wrapped up the weekend with the Highest Aggregate Score in Trail (an amazing accomplishment I'm told). I am hoping to handle him at the Lethbridge Dog Show (June '07) for his CDX obedience title. Outside of work, Indy is a typical Flat-Coat: full of energy, kissing everyone, carrying things in his mouth - everything a retriever is meant to be! Thank you to Indy's owners, Katheryn & Brad Taylor, for letting me work with Indy and bring home some titles!! |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
